Why detox is the very first step, not the whole treatment

Alcohol adjustments brain chemistry in time. The nerves adapts to frequent drinking by working more difficult to preserve balance. When alcohol is instantly gotten rid of, that overcorrected system can surge right into withdrawal. Mild situations might include shakiness, queasiness, sweating, stress and anxiety, inadequate sleep, and irritation. More serious instances can involve hallucinations, seizures, harmful spikes in blood pressure, and ecstasy tremens, frequently called DTs. DTs are a clinical emergency.

This is where many people get floundered. They presume detox and rehabilitation are compatible terms. They are not. Alcohol detox addresses the prompt physical process of withdrawal. Alcohol rehab addresses the behavior, psychological, and social motorists that maintain the drinking cycle going. An individual might finish detox in numerous days, really feel more clear, and believe the issue has been taken care of. Then stress and anxiety returns, food cravings hit, old regimens begin, and regression takes place swiftly because the deeper work never started.

Clinically, detoxification has to do with safety and stablizing. Rehabilitation has to do with learning just how to stay sober when life comes to be uncomfortable once more. Both issue. One without the other often brings about duplicate admissions, repeated assurances, and expanding discouragement.

What takes place prior to detox begins

A respectable program does not start by handing somebody a bed and a schedule. It begins with assessment. In alcohol rehab Charlotte programs, that typically indicates a testimonial of alcohol consumption history, existing usage, past withdrawal episodes, drugs, clinical problems, psychological wellness symptoms, and any type of other materials aware, including benzodiazepines, opioids, marijuana, or energizers. Staff also want to know whether the individual has actually ever had seizures, hallucinations, or DTs during prior efforts to quit.

This very early evaluation matters greater than people recognize. Two people can consume similar quantities and have extremely different withdrawal danger. One may have mild symptoms. Another might weaken swiftly due to age, liver issues, dehydration, poor nutrition, or prior complex withdrawals. Clinicians additionally take a look at useful concerns, whether the individual has secure real estate, whether there is family assistance, whether they are pregnant, and whether they can securely manage outpatient care or need inpatient monitoring.

A careful team will likewise screen for co-occurring problems. Depression, stress and anxiety, injury, bipolar illness, and sleep conditions often take a trip alongside alcohol usage. Occasionally the alcohol consumption began as self-medication. Occasionally alcohol made an existing condition even worse. Sorting that out takes experience, because the very first days of sobriety can briefly increase psychological signs. A good program does not hurry to identify whatever too quickly, yet it does not neglect warning signs either.

What alcohol withdrawal generally really feels like

The timeline varies, however many people start feeling signs and symptoms within several hours after their last drink. Early withdrawal often starts with tremblings, restlessness, sweating, nausea or vomiting, migraine, competing ideas, and sleep problems. Some individuals define it as really feeling electrically "on side," as if their body can not settle. Their hands drink when they try to text. Their heart extra pounds. They may vow they are not that unwell, after that panic by evening when the symptoms intensify.

Somewhere in the initial one to 3 days, the danger of severe complications has a tendency to be greatest. This is why medically monitored alcohol detox is so crucial, especially for anyone with a long background of hefty drinking or previous withdrawal episodes. Hallucinations can occur. Seizures can occur. High blood pressure can climb. Confusion can deepen rapidly. By the time relative understand something is seriously incorrect, the circumstance may already require emergency situation care.

After the intense stage, people often anticipate to feel typical immediately. Generally they do not. Sleep can remain interfered with for days or weeks. Mood can turn. Cravings might return unevenly. Concentration can be inadequate. This duration is awkward however usual, and it is one reason early treatment planning matters. Vulnerability remains high after the dramatic physical symptoms ease.

The function of clinical detoxification in maintaining individuals safe

Medical alcohol detox is designed to stop difficulties and reduce suffering while the body removes alcohol and regains equilibrium. In useful terms, that can include regular surveillance of crucial signs, sign scoring, hydration assistance, drug to decrease the threat of seizures and extreme withdrawal, nutritional supplementation, and therapy for coexisting clinical issues.

Thiamine, a form of vitamin B1, is often crucial due to the fact that chronic alcohol use can deplete it and raise the risk of major neurological troubles. Liquids might be needed if an individual has actually been vomiting, sweating greatly, or disregarding nutrition. Sleep may require support. If someone shows up with elevated high blood pressure, liver problems, or indications of infection, those concerns can not be separated from the detoxification plan.

Medications are taken care of thoroughly. The specific strategy varies relying on the individual's background, severity of signs and symptoms, age, and overall wellness. Excellent programs likewise pay attention to the atmosphere. A tranquil setup, foreseeable check-ins, and seasoned team can make a major difference. Withdrawal intensifies fear. When people know a person skilled is watching their signs and symptoms and reacting early, they are more probable to remain in treatment as opposed to leaving against clinical advice.

In Charlotte, degrees of care differ from center to facility. Some facilities use medically managed inpatient detoxification with day-and-night guidance. Others provide ambulatory or outpatient detoxification for meticulously evaluated people who are medically stable and have strong assistance. The ideal fit depends on threat, not convenience alone.

Inpatient versus outpatient alcohol detox in Charlotte

One of one of the most typical inquiries is whether somebody can detox at home and attend consultations during the day, or whether they need a residential setup. Outpatient detoxification can benefit individuals with milder withdrawal risk, trustworthy transport, a risk-free home environment, and no history of severe complications. It can also match people that can not step away from family members or benefit an extensive period, though "can not" deserves examination. I have actually seen many individuals insist they might not potentially stop benefit five days, only to shed far more time later on because the problem worsened.

Inpatient detoxification is usually the more secure selection when heavy everyday alcohol consumption has been going on for a very long time, when prior withdrawals were extreme, when other medical or psychological problems exist, or when the home environment is disorderly or proactively allowing. It likewise provides team the chance to observe what a person is like when alcohol is no more in the system. In some cases the anxiety raises greater than anticipated. In some cases the anxiousness continues to be strong and needs concentrated treatment. In some cases memory spaces or confusion factor toward medical issues that would have been missed out on in a less structured setting.

For people searching for alcohol detox Charlotte care, the much better question is not "What is most convenient?" yet "What is secure, lasting, and realistic for this certain individual?"

What the very first couple of days in rehabilitation typically look like

Once detoxification starts, time can really feel odd. The first 24 hours are usually regarding triage, getting resolved, answering duplicated questions, having important signs inspected, meeting nursing staff, and attempting to remainder. Several individuals arrive embarrassed, tired, or defensive. Some are unstable and nauseated. Some are still lessening the problem. Some are deeply soothed to have actually handed responsibility to someone else for a little while.

By day 2 or three, if the withdrawal is being handled effectively, the fog may begin to lift. This is usually when feelings land. Remorse, sorrow, temper, and fear can hit hard. People believe they are going in to manage a physical problem, then understand just how much alcohol had actually been numbing. In a strong program, this phase is met with structure as opposed to stress. Early counseling works, but requiring somebody into extensive psychological excavation while they are still physiologically unstable is seldom helpful.

As the individual supports, the timetable normally ends up being even more arranged. That can include individual sessions, team treatment, education and learning regarding relapse patterns, psychological assessment if needed, and planning for following steps. Meals come to be important once more. Rest begins to improve, though generally not at one time. Family members might be brought in, particularly if they are part of the discharge plan.

What "rehabilitation" actually indicates after detox

A great deal of the general public creativity around alcohol rehab focuses on detox beds and withdrawal signs, yet the even more crucial job starts after severe detox mores than. Excellent alcoholism treatment asks hard, functional questions. What function did alcohol play in this individual's day? When did they consume alcohol, with whom, after what sensations, and in reaction to what stress factors? What occurs in between the initial idea of drinking and the initial sip? Where are the blind spots?

For one Charlotte company owner I once heard explained in treatment, the risk hour was not late in the evening. It was 4:30 p.m., when the day alleviated and he really felt the abrupt decrease from stress right into vacuum. For a young mom, it was the two-hour stretch after the youngsters went to bed, when solitude and resentment emerged. For a senior citizen, it was golf society and the social expectation to consume greatly due to the fact that "that's just what every person does." The point is not that every person has the same triggers. The factor is that healing ends up being more practical when the pattern is called in particular terms.

Treatment might involve cognitive behavior modification, motivational interviewing, trauma-informed treatment, relapse avoidance preparation, medicine analysis, and family job. Some patients shift from detoxification into domestic rehabilitation. Others move right into a partial hospitalization program or intensive outpatient treatment. The strength depends on severity, security, relapse history, and what type of support exists at home.

The function of medication in alcohol addiction treatment

Medication can be an integral part of treatment, though it is not a standalone solution. During detoxification, drugs may be used to decrease the danger of withdrawal issues and make signs and symptoms more manageable. After detox, some clients may gain from medicines that help in reducing desires or make drinking much less gratifying. Not everybody is a prospect, and medicine functions best when paired with counseling and recovery planning.

This is one area where shame can hinder. Some individuals believe taking medication implies they are not "really sober." That is not a medical sight, and it is not a useful one. If medication assists an individual stay alive, minimize relapse threat, and engage in therapy, it is entitled to thoughtful factor to consider. The appropriate question is whether the treatment strategy is improving feature and sustaining continual recovery.

What families ought to expect, and what they commonly misunderstand

Families usually come into alcohol rehab bring 2 conflicting ideas. First, they wish therapy will finally "fix" the individual. Second, they have actually learned not to trust fund promises. Both responses make sense. Coping with energetic alcohol usage can educate people to check for deception, dilemma, and dissatisfaction. But relative likewise require to change their assumptions. Detoxification does not recover trust fund over night. A week in therapy does not eliminate years of chaos.

What families can sensibly expect is a much safer medical withdrawal, a more truthful professional image, and the beginning of a healing plan. They can likewise expect to listen to uneasy realities regarding making it possible for, boundaries, and communication. Often the healthiest household support is not saving. It is allowing consequences while remaining engaged in a gauged, educated way.

A useful shift aids. Rather than asking, "Do they suggest it this time?" ask, "What actions remain in area after discharge?" Is there therapy set up? Are there follow-up consultations? Have driving, childcare, job, and living plans been resolved? Exists a plan for food cravings, relapse warning signs, and what to do if alcohol consumption resumes? Healing ends up being much easier to evaluate when it is linked to actions rather than declarations.

The stretch after rehabilitation, where relapse risk lives

If there is a point where individuals end up being overconfident, it is generally after the physical anguish discolors. They feel much better, look better, and presume the threat has actually passed. This is exactly when lots of regressions take place. The noticeable suffering is gone, yet the behaviors, social signs, psychological triggers, and benefit paths are still active.

Early recovery normally goes much better when day-to-day live is deliberately narrowed for some time. That might imply skipping particular occasions, transforming regimens, staying clear of old alcohol consumption companions, and approving even more framework than really feels natural. For high-functioning specialists, this can really feel specifically annoying. They desire soberness to fit neatly right into the life they currently had. Commonly some redesign is required.

A valuable discharge plan normally consists of a combination of treatment, peer support, clinical follow-up, and certain relapse-prevention steps. It may also involve sober living, especially for people whose homes are unpredictable or saturated with alcohol. The best alcohol rehab Charlotte programs do not release individuals with unclear encouragement. They hand off to the next degree of care with appointments, calls, and a strategy the person can really follow.

When to look for aid urgently

There are times when research and comparison-shopping need to quit and urgent assessment must begin. If a person is consuming greatly daily and can not go numerous hours without signs and symptoms, if they have a background of seizures during withdrawal, if they are perplexed or hallucinating, or if they are blending alcohol with sedatives, instant medical assessment is warranted. The same is true if self-destructive thoughts are present.

A person does not need to hit a dramatic stereotype of all-time low to require therapy. Some people enter alcohol detox since their marriage is fraying. Some because their liver enzymes returned high. Some because they are covertly drinking in the morning to quit their hands from drinking prior to job. Severity is not gauged only by public damage. Personal wear and tear counts too.

How long does alcohol detox take in Charlotte?

Alcohol detox typically lasts between 3 and 10 days. Withdrawal symptoms often begin within 6 to 24 hours after the last drink and peak within 24 to 72 hours. Most acute symptoms improve within a week. Recovery timelines vary depending on individual health and alcohol use history.

What medications are used during alcohol detox in Charlotte?

Medications used during alcohol detox often include benzodiazepines to reduce withdrawal symptoms and prevent complications. Other medications may be prescribed to manage nausea, anxiety, insomnia, or cravings. Vitamin supplementation, particularly thiamine, is also commonly provided. Medication choices depend on individual medical needs and symptom severity.

How long do alcohol withdrawal symptoms last in Charlotte?

Alcohol withdrawal symptoms generally begin within 6 to 24 hours after drinking stops and peak within the first three days. Most acute symptoms improve within 5 to 7 days. Some individuals experience prolonged symptoms, such as anxiety or sleep disturbances, for several weeks. Recovery timelines vary among individuals.
